Physical Requirements

Anything listed here requires a pre‑employment physical by Employee Health to determine if the employee is capable of meeting the requirements.

Physical Activity
  • Ability to stand and ambulate at least 7 hours of an 8 hour or 9 hours of a 10 hour shift
  • Frequent lifting, stretching, and reaching
  • Excellent visual acuity necessary with correction (glasses or contacts) 20/30 including color distinction and depth perception
  • Auditory senses intact with or without correction
  • Repetitive motion demands
Mental Activity
  • Shows adaptability and alertness
  • Capable of good judgment
  • Able to coordinate activities and apply learned principles
  • Shows ability to coordinate ideas and follow directions
  • Cooperative with co‑workers
  • Mental stamina to withstand stress
Environmental Exposure
  • Blood and bodily fluids
  • Communicable diseases
  • Chemicals
  • Radiation
Upper Extremity
  • Use of Upper Extremity - 67% to 100%
Push/Pull/Lift/Carry
  • Initial push up to a maximum of 55 lbs - 34% to 66%
  • Initial pull up to a maximum of 42 lbs - 34% to 66%
  • Sustained push up to a maximum of 25 lbs - 34% to 66%
  • Sustained pull up to a maximum of 18 lbs - 34% to 66%
  • Lift up to a maximum of 35 lbs - 1% to 33%
  • Carry up to a maximum of 35 lbs - 1% to 33%
PART TWO: FUNCTIONAL RESPONSIBILITY Position Objective

The Lead Surgical Technologist is responsible to assist the daily operations of the surgical tech team, ensuring the sterile environment is maintained, and assisting the surgical team with high‑quality support setting for and during procedures. This role includes mentoring and training staff, ensuring adherence to safety and regulatory standards, and collaborating with physicians, nurses, leaders, and other medical professionals to deliver optimal patient care.

The Lead Surgical Technologist will also serve as a resource for troubleshooting and improving workflow efficiencies within the surgical and procedural setting while maintaining calm, focused environment during high‑pressure situations.

Performance Expectation Lead Surgical Technologist
  • Serve as the Lead on daily shifts to resolve/answer any questions or issues. Teach both skill and theoretical principles to new employees and students
  • Assists Perioperative Leaders to ensure unit compliance with quality, safety, regulatory requirements, and CMS standards
  • Assists the OR Service Leader in analyzing data, ensuring team adherence to performance standards, and improving processes continuously
  • Demonstrate initiative in problem solving as related to patient and technical issues that contribute to the improvement of the Operating Room function and operation
  • Proficient in all surgical services and endoscopy procedures performed at APD to serve as a preceptor and resource to employees.
  • Proficient in our instrumentation tracking system SPM
  • Proficient in Provation our endoscopy documentation system
  • Provides mentoring to the CSR, OR assistant, and CST
  • Works collaboratively and has respect for and understanding other clinical disciplines
